Overview of the Gaomon M10K Pro 2026

The Gaomon M10K Pro 2026 is an upgraded drawing tablet designed for professional and hobbyist artists. It features a large active area, high resolution, and a battery-free pen that promises precision and ease of use.

Pen Quality

The pen included with the M10K Pro 2026 is notable for its lightweight design and ergonomic grip. It uses electromagnetic resonance technology, allowing for a battery-free experience, which reduces weight and maintenance.

Material quality is solid, with a smooth exterior that feels comfortable during extended use. The pen tip offers a good balance between softness and durability, contributing to a natural drawing experience.

Pen Sensitivity and Pressure Levels

The pen supports up to 8192 pressure levels, providing nuanced control over line thickness and shading. Artists report that pressure sensitivity is responsive and consistent across different applications.

Responsiveness and Performance

The Gaomon M10K Pro 2026 boasts a high report rate, reducing lag and ensuring that strokes are captured instantly. This responsiveness is critical for detailed artwork and quick sketches.

Connection via USB-C provides a stable and fast link to the computer, minimizing latency. The tablet also supports wireless connection options, enhancing flexibility for users.

Testing the Responsiveness

During testing, the pen responded accurately to various pressure and tilt inputs. Artists noted that the cursor movement felt natural, with minimal delay even during fast strokes.
